Garlic-Chile Ground Pork

A savory Asian-inspired ground pork dish featuring aromatic garlic, spicy chile, and umami-rich sauces. The meat is simmered in chicken broth until tender and flavorful, finished with a touch of rice vinegar for brightness.

4 servings
32 min

Ingredients

  • 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
  • 1 whole shallot
  • 4 cloves garlic
  • 1 whole dried chile
  • 1 pound ground pork
  • 1 tablespoon fish sauce
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ce
  • 1 pinch sugar
  • 1 cup low-sodium chicken broth
  • 2 teaspoons unseasoned rice vinegar
  • 1 to taste Kosher salt

Cooking Instructions

  1. 1.

    Heat oil in a medium skillet over medium-high. Cook shallot, garlic, and chile, stirring often, until shallot is softened and translucent, about 4 minutes. Add pork and cook, stirring occasionally, until almost cooked through, about 3 minutes. Add fish sauce, soy sauce, and sugar and cook, stirring occasionally, until moisture in skillet is evaporated, about 5 minutes. Add broth, reduce heat, and simmer, uncovered, stirring occasionally, until liquid is evaporated, 12-18 minutes.

  2. 2.

    Remove skillet from heat and mix vinegar into pork mixture; taste and season with salt if needed.
